为什么效率工具推荐?

李桂英
2025-06-18 15:53
阅读 451

在当今信息爆炸、工作节奏飞快的时代,效率工具已经不仅仅是办公助手那么简单了。它们是我们在学习、工作中提升生产力的秘密武器。然而,对于完全没有接触过编程或技术工具的新手来说,面对琳琅满目的软件和工具,往往无从下手。本文就是为这些完全零基础的朋友量身打造的——我们不讲复杂的术语,也不跳过任何一个基础细节。你将从“这是什么”开始,逐步了解效率工具的重要性,并亲手搭建环境、实践操作。

本教程的目标非常明确:让你真正理解什么是效率工具,为什么它值得你使用,以及如何入门上手。无论你是学生、职场新人还是自由职业者,只要你想提高自己的工作效率,这篇文章都将为你打开一扇新的大门。


第一步:什么是效率工具?它能帮我们做什么?

自动化部署流程-1

第一步:什么是效率工具?它能帮我们做什么?

效率工具是什么?

简单来说,**效率工具(Productivity Tools)**是一种可以帮助我们更高效地完成任务、节省时间、减少重复性劳动的软件工具。它可以是电脑上的应用程序,也可以是手机上的小插件,甚至是一些自动化脚本。

比如:

  • 记笔记用的 Notion、Typora
  • 做计划的日历 App 或 Trello
  • 管理项目的 Asana、Jira
  • 自动化的 IFTTT、Zapier
  • 代码编辑器 VS Code、Sublime Text

但如果我们学会一些简单的开发知识,比如写一点小程序或自动化脚本,就能让效率工具变得更强大!


为什么推荐效率工具?

我们来看看几个实际场景:

场景一:重复性的工作

比如每天都要整理 Excel 表格中的数据,手动做这些很费时。但如果你会点 Python,写个脚本一键处理,几分钟搞定。

场景二:集中管理你的工作内容

如果你用多个 App 做任务管理、日程安排、资料整理,很容易遗漏。而一个好的效率工具(如 Notion)可以帮你把所有内容集中在一处,轻松查找与管理。

场景三:远程协作更顺畅

像腾讯文档、GitHub、Slack 这些工具可以让团队实时协作,不再需要反复发文件、找版本。

所以你看,掌握效率工具,不是为了炫技,而是实实在在帮我们节省时间、提高质量


第二步:环境准备 —— 打开你的“工具箱”

第二步:环境准备 —— 打开你的“工具箱”

在我们开始使用效率工具之前,首先要确保我们具备一个基本的开发环境。别担心,这并不复杂,而且我们可以一步一步来。

1. 安装 Python(推荐初学者)

Python 是目前最易学、功能最强大的编程语言之一。我们将使用它来运行一些简单的脚本帮助我们实现自动化。

Windows 系统安装步骤:

  1. 访问官网: https://www.python.org/
  2. 点击 “Downloads”
  3. 选择下载适合你系统的版本(例如 Windows x86-64 executable installer
  4. 双击安装程序
  5. 勾选“Add Python to PATH”后点击“Install Now”
  6. 安装完成后,打开命令提示符(cmd),输入以下命令查看是否安装成功:

版本控制工具使用-2

python --version

如果输出类似 Python 3.10.6 的版本号,恭喜你,安装成功!

Mac 和 Linux 用户:

通常系统自带 Python,但也建议到官网更新最新版。可以用终端检查:

python3 --version

2. 安装 VS Code(代码编辑器)

VS Code 是一个免费、轻便、功能强大的代码编辑器,非常适合新手使用。

安装步骤:

  1. 打开官网:https://code.visualstudio.com/
  2. 下载对应系统的安装包
  3. 双击安装即可
  4. 安装完成后,打开 VS Code,点击左上角【文件】→ 新建文件,保存为 .py 文件即可用来编写 Python 脚本

3. 安装常用库(如 pandas)

我们要处理数据,就要用到 Python 中非常流行的库:pandas

在命令行中执行:

pip install pandas

等待一段时间后,安装完成。


第三步:核心概念讲解 —— 真正理解你要使用的工具

虽然我们现在还没开始写项目,但我们先来认识几个关键概念,这样后面实战的时候你会更容易理解。

1. 编程 = 自动化任务

你可以把编程看作是一种“让计算机自动做事”的方式。

比如:每天定时导出报表 → 写个脚本自动跑 → 完成!

2. 什么是“脚本”?

**脚本(Script)**就是一个文本文件,里面写了一些命令,计算机可以按照顺序一步步去执行。Python 脚本的扩展名通常是 .py

3. 什么是“变量”?

**变量(Variable)**就像是一个“容器”,可以存储数据。例如:

name = "张三"
age = 25
print(name)

这段代码中,“name”和“age”就是变量。我们可以给变量命名、赋值、修改。

4. 什么是“函数”?

**函数(Function)**就是一堆预先写好的指令,可以通过名字直接调用。比如:

def say_hello():
    print("你好!")

say_hello()

结果就会输出:“你好!”


第四步:动手实战 —— 写一个简单的效率脚本

现在我们来做一个超实用的小项目:批量重命名文件夹里的图片文件

情景描述:

假设你有很多张图片,名称杂乱无章,比如:

DSC_001.jpg
IMG_20230502_123456.jpg
PXL_20230101_090034.jpg
...

你想统一命名为 photo_001.jpgphoto_002.jpg…怎么做呢?手动改太慢,我们来写个脚本。


实现步骤:

第一步:准备测试图片

新建一个文件夹,放入几张 .jpg 图片。

第二步:在 VS Code 中创建脚本

创建一个文件,名为 rename_photos.py,粘贴如下代码:

import os

# 设置目标文件夹路径
folder_path = "./photos"  # 请根据实际情况修改路径
new_prefix = "photo"

# 获取目录下所有 jpg 文件
files = [f for f in os.listdir(folder_path) if f.endswith('.jpg')]

# 对文件进行排序(可选)
files.sort()

# 开始重命名
for i, filename in enumerate(files):
    old_path = os.path.join(folder_path, filename)
    new_filename = f"{new_prefix}_{i+1:03d}.jpg"  # 格式:photo_001.jpg
    new_path = os.path.join(folder_path, new_filename)
    os.rename(old_path, new_path)

print("重命名完成!")

第三步:运行脚本

打开命令行,进入该脚本所在目录,执行:

python rename_photos.py

如果你的文件夹路径设置正确,你会看到所有的图片都被批量重命名为标准格式!


小结这个项目教会我们的知识点:

技术点 学到了什么
os.listdir() 获取文件列表
os.path.join() 安全拼接路径
enumerate() 同时获取索引和元素
str.format() 格式化字符串
os.rename() 重命名文件

第五步:常见问题解答(FAQ)

刚开始使用效率工具,肯定会有各种疑问。这里列出几个最常见的问题:

Q1:我不会编程,也能用这些效率工具吗?

当然可以!很多效率工具(比如 Notion、Trello、Excel 高级公式)都不需要编程技能。但如果你想深度定制、实现自动化,就建议学习一点点编程基础,如 Python。


Q2:为什么我的脚本运行失败?

有可能是:

  • 文件路径写错了,请仔细检查 folder_path
  • 文件被其他程序占用(比如打开了某张图片)
  • 没有权限操作该文件夹

建议运行前关闭相关文件,检查路径是否正确。


Q3:我想做的自动化别人还没写过怎么办?

别担心!你可以参考官方文档,或者搜索“xxx python tutorial”找到类似的案例,再根据自己的需求调整。遇到问题可以在 Stack Overflow 提问,那里有大量的程序员愿意帮忙。


第六步:下一步学习建议 —— 从“会用”到“精通”

一旦你掌握了上面的内容,说明你已经迈出了第一步。接下来你可以尝试以下几个方向继续学习:

学习路径建议:

方向一:进阶自动化

  • 学习使用 selenium 自动化浏览器操作
  • 学习使用 scheduleAPScheduler 定时执行任务
  • 使用 TkinterStreamlit 创建图形界面工具

方向二:数据分析与可视化

  • 学习 pandas 处理表格数据
  • 学习 matplotlib / seaborn 生成图表
  • 学习 openpyxl 处理 Excel 文件

方向三:使用 API 接口增强工具能力

  • 使用第三方 API(如百度翻译、天气查询)开发小工具
  • 学习使用 GitHub API 自动化项目管理
  • 探索 AI 工具接口(如 OpenAI 的 ChatGPT)整合进你的脚本

总结:效率工具的价值不止于工具本身

通过这篇教程,你已经学会了:

✅ 什么是效率工具及其价值
✅ 如何搭建基础的开发环境
✅ 一些重要的核心概念
✅ 动手实现了第一个小项目
✅ 解决了一些常见问题
✅ 了解了后续的学习方向

最后送大家一句话:

“工具只是手段,真正的核心在于你能如何利用它创造价值。”

希望你能在这条路上越走越远,成为真正高效的人。如果你有任何问题,欢迎随时留言交流。技术的世界很大,我们一起探索吧!


(全文约3937字)

评论 0

最热最新
暂无评论
匿名用户Lv.1
0
影响力
0
文章
0
粉丝